Choosing between Rome, Italy and Singapore, Singapore is one of the most common dilemmas facing digital nomads, expats, and remote workers in 2026. Both cities offer unique advantages. But the right choice depends entirely on your priorities, budget, and lifestyle preferences.
In this comprehensive comparison, we analyze Rome and Singapore across 12 critical categories: Economic Factors, Quality of Life, Infrastructure & Connectivity, Housing & Living Spaces, and 8 more categories. Each category is scored on a 0-100 scale using data from over 20 verified sources, including Numbeo, WHO, Speedtest, and local government statistics.
Rome earns an overall score of 71.51/100, while Singapore scores 79.80/100. A 8.29-point modest gap that Singapore leads. But headline scores never tell the full story. Let's break down exactly where each city excels and where it falls short.
Rome is described as: "The Eternal City. Unmatched history and cuisine, but bureaucracy can be challenging." Meanwhile, Singapore is known as: "The gold standard for safety and efficiency. A compact city-state with world-class everything." These reputations are earned. But how do they hold up under rigorous data analysis? Read on.
Economic Factors
Rome
61Singapore
70In economic factors, Singapore takes the lead with a score of 70/100 compared to 61/100. This category covers employment & income, cost factors, economic environment.
Singapore has a commanding lead in employment & income (87 vs 49). Rome has a commanding lead in cost factors (66 vs 37). Singapore has a commanding lead in economic environment (95 vs 64).
Singapore stands out for business regulations, banking system, economic stability, though housing costs and education costs could be improved. Rome performs well in currency stability and healthcare costs despite the overall gap.

Quality of Life
Rome
75Singapore
77In quality of life, Singapore takes the lead with a score of 77/100 compared to 75/100. This category covers healthcare, education, safety & environment, climate & nature.
Singapore has a solid advantage in education (92 vs 79). Singapore has a commanding lead in safety & environment (87 vs 65). Rome has a commanding lead in climate & nature (82 vs 52).
Singapore stands out for english-speaking medical staff, personal safety, crime rates, though mountains/hiking and rainfall patterns could be improved. Rome performs well in natural beauty and universities despite the overall gap.
